James Watson's Choice Collection of Comic and Serious Scots Poems
Discover the rich tapestry of Scottish literature with James Watson's Choice Collection of Comic and Serious Scots Poems, expertly curated by Harriet Harvey Wood. Published in 1991, this hardback edition spans 384 pages and stands as the first known printed collection of Older Scots verse, marking a significant milestone in Scottish literary history.
